计件工资修改

master
Yangwl 11 months ago
parent 2f2beda622
commit 79af2cb25b

@ -1,9 +1,13 @@
package com.op.mes.controller; package com.op.mes.controller;
import java.util.HashMap;
import java.util.List; import java.util.List;
import java.util.Map;
import javax.servlet.http.HttpServletResponse; import javax.servlet.http.HttpServletResponse;
import com.op.mes.domain.MesUnitPrice;
import com.op.mes.domain.MesUnitpriceReport; import com.op.mes.domain.MesUnitpriceReport;
import com.op.mes.service.IMesUnitPriceService;
import com.op.mes.service.IMesUnitpriceReportService; import com.op.mes.service.IMesUnitpriceReportService;
import org.springframework.beans.factory.annotation.Autowired; import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.GetMapping; import org.springframework.web.bind.annotation.GetMapping;
@ -34,6 +38,8 @@ import com.op.common.core.web.page.TableDataInfo;
public class MesUnitPriceReportController extends BaseController { public class MesUnitPriceReportController extends BaseController {
@Autowired @Autowired
private IMesUnitpriceReportService mesUnitpriceReportService; private IMesUnitpriceReportService mesUnitpriceReportService;
@Autowired
private IMesUnitPriceService mesUnitPriceService;
/** /**
* *
@ -64,7 +70,16 @@ public class MesUnitPriceReportController extends BaseController {
@RequiresPermissions("unitPriceReport:report:query") @RequiresPermissions("unitPriceReport:report:query")
@GetMapping(value = "/{id}") @GetMapping(value = "/{id}")
public AjaxResult getInfo(@PathVariable("id") String id) { public AjaxResult getInfo(@PathVariable("id") String id) {
return success(mesUnitpriceReportService.selectMesUnitpriceReportById(id));
MesUnitpriceReport mup=mesUnitpriceReportService.selectMesUnitpriceReportById(id);
MesUnitPrice mesUnitPrice=new MesUnitPrice();
mesUnitPrice.setProductCode(mup.getProductCode().substring(mup.getProductCode().length() - 11));
mesUnitPrice.setLineCode(mup.getLineCode());
List<MesUnitPrice> list = mesUnitPriceService.selectMesUnitPriceList(mesUnitPrice);
Map map=new HashMap();
map.put("MesUnitpriceReport",mup);
map.put("MesUnitPriceInfo",list);
return success(map);
} }
/** /**

@ -44,6 +44,7 @@
mur.product_name, mur.product_name,
mur.line_code, mur.line_code,
mur.attr1 AS real_wages, mur.attr1 AS real_wages,
mur.remark,
be.equipment_name, be.equipment_name,
mur.nick_name, mur.nick_name,
mur.childprocess_code, mur.childprocess_code,
@ -101,6 +102,7 @@
mur.product_name, mur.product_name,
mur.attr1, mur.attr1,
mur.line_code, mur.line_code,
mur.remark,
be.equipment_name, be.equipment_name,
mur.nick_name, mur.nick_name,
mur.childprocess_code, mur.childprocess_code,
@ -166,15 +168,15 @@
<!-- <if test="productCode != null">product_code = #{productCode},</if>--> <!-- <if test="productCode != null">product_code = #{productCode},</if>-->
<!-- <if test="userName != null and userName != ''">user_name = #{userName},</if>--> <!-- <if test="userName != null and userName != ''">user_name = #{userName},</if>-->
<!-- <if test="nickName != null and nickName != ''">nick_name = #{nickName},</if>--> <!-- <if test="nickName != null and nickName != ''">nick_name = #{nickName},</if>-->
<!-- <if test="childprocessCode != null">childprocess_code = #{childprocessCode},</if>--> <if test="childprocessCode != null">childprocess_code = #{childprocessCode},</if>
<!-- <if test="childprocessName != null">childprocess_name = #{childprocessName},</if>--> <if test="childprocessName != null">childprocess_name = #{childprocessName},</if>
<if test="attr1 != null">attr1 = #{attr1},</if> <if test="attr1 != null">attr1 = #{attr1},</if>
<!-- <if test="attr2 != null">attr2 = #{attr2},</if>--> <if test="attr2 != null">attr2 = #{attr2},</if>
<!-- <if test="attr3 != null">attr3 = #{attr3},</if>--> <if test="attr3 != null">attr3 = #{attr3},</if>
<!-- <if test="createBy != null">create_by = #{createBy},</if>--> <if test="createBy != null">create_by = #{createBy},</if>
<!-- <if test="createTime != null">create_time = #{createTime},</if>--> <if test="createTime != null">create_time = #{createTime},</if>
<!-- <if test="updateBy != null">update_by = #{updateBy},</if>--> <if test="updateBy != null">update_by = #{updateBy},</if>
<!-- <if test="updateTime != null">update_time = #{updateTime},</if>--> <if test="updateTime != null">update_time = #{updateTime},</if>
<if test="remark != null">remark = #{remark},</if> <if test="remark != null">remark = #{remark},</if>
</trim> </trim>
where id = #{id} where id = #{id}

Loading…
Cancel
Save